        <description>by Andrew Lee (李健秋) At: MiniDebConf Hamburg 2026 https://hamburg2026.mini.debconf.org/talks/28-rescue-forky-we-have-go-back-to-2011-building-go-like-its-2011-is-broken/ Hidden Injections, 404 Errors, and the Path to Modern Builds. When a modern Go package is added to Debian, it should just work. But what if a perfectly compiled binary fails at runtime with a "404 Not Found" error that nobody can explain? After our investigation: We found Debian’s Go infrastructure is trapped Bookworm and Trixie in a time machine in 2011. How can we rescue "Forky" (Debian 14) from the past and bring our Go builds back to the present and ready for the future? Room: Seminarroom Scheduled start: 2026-05-09 13:00:00+02:00</description>
